|
ru.unix.bsd- RU.UNIX.BSD ------------------------------------------------------------------ From : Sergey Skvortsov 2:5020/400 21 Nov 2005 16:59:11 To : Victor Sudakov Subject : Re: send mail -------------------------------------------------------------------------------- Victor Sudakov wrote: >>> Как должны будут передаваться credentials в командную строку вызова >>> Exim в этом случае? >> Как угодно. Хоть через макросы: exim -DAUTH_USER=xxx ... > > Hе годится, потому что всё это будет видно в списке процессов. > >> Или через заголовки. > Вот это более подходящий вариант. Пример такого решения есть? А что тут решать? В своем MUA настраиваешь выдачу заголовков. В exim'е роутишь на основании присутствия в письме оных, и раскрываешь credentials через их содержимое, типа: client_name = $bh_X-INTERNAL-AUTH-USER: client_secret = $bh_X-INTERNAL-AUTH-PASS: Hу и заголовки эти конечно надо удалять перед отправкой (в транспорте). > Hу, sql это уже перебор, а вот вариант с передачей через хедеры мне Почему перебор? Sqlite быстрее любого dbm. Или даже можно тупо в cdb - просто хранить в $home/mail.cdb параметры и всё. -- Sergey Skvortsov mailto: skv@protey.ru --- ifmail v.2.15dev5.3 * Origin: Demos online service (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.unix.bsd/6577154badbe.html, оценка из 5, голосов 10
|